Distance From Baotou Airport to Chengdu Airport (BAV - CTU Distance)
The flight distance from Baotou Airport (BAV) to Chengdu Airport (CTU) is 769 miles. This is equivalent to 1237 kilometers or 668 nautical miles. The distance shown below is the straight line distance (may be called as flying or air distance) or direct flight distance between airports.
1237 kilometers is the distance from Baotou Airport, China to Chengdu Airport, China.
